Add an OKF-conformant starter pack: ok seed --pack okf (also shown by ok seed --list-packs) scaffolds a small knowledge base that is conformant with Google's Open Knowledge Format (OKF) v0.1 from the first commit — every non-reserved doc carries a non-empty type, plus a frontmatter-free lowercase index.md (§6 navigation) and log.md (§7 change history). Pure pre-populated content: the native frontmatter schema stays open-shaped and nothing is enforced or linted. Ships a guidance-only OKF conventions skill like every other pack.

* feat(open-knowledge): OKF-conformant starter pack (PRD-7119)

Add an `okf` entry to the `ok seed` STARTER_PACKS registry: a small mini-KB
that is conformant with Google's Open Knowledge Format (OKF) v0.1 by
construction. Every non-reserved seed doc carries a non-empty `type` (§9
rules 1-2); a lowercase, frontmatter-free `index.md` (§6 navigation) and
`log.md` (§7 change history) follow the reserved-file conventions (§9 rule 3).

Pure pre-populated content — the native frontmatter schema stays open-shaped,
nothing is enforced or linted, and `ok init` is untouched. The pack reuses the
pack-agnostic plan/apply/CLI/picker pipeline unchanged (only the registry
literal + `PackId` union widen), so it auto-appears in `ok seed --list-packs`.
Seeded links use standard markdown (a conformant OKF bundle's link graph is
plain markdown; `[[…]]` is an OK superset the export normalizes away).

Ships a guidance-only pack-local skill and an OKF §9 conformance test that runs
the real seed pipeline and asserts all three rules over the written bytes
(templates checked at their instantiated block-2 form), plus idempotent re-run.
